Transaction 8af79b518cbea6cc93dcdd64ca311a79ace02c1363d44fcaa6d9a74b40ced6d3
1 Input
1 Output
-
8af79b518cbea6cc93dcdd64ca311a79ace02c1363d44fcaa6d9a74b40ced6d3:0
- value
- 10390149
- script pubkey
- OP_0 OP_PUSHBYTES_20 2851d860f2012380a76b1fc75eab3a4ac8550126
- address
- bc1q9pgasc8jqy3cpfmtrlr4a2e6fty92qfxe77yey